Character
Fineapple opens with a loud, almost synthetic pineapple blast that’s more candied than ripe, backed by a tart green apple snap. The ambrette musks the fruit with a fuzzy, soapy warmth before magnolia and jasmine drift in as a delicate floral counterpoint, keeping things bright and polite. The woody base is barely a whisper, a distant plank that does little to anchor the sweetness. The overall feel is a tropical fruit salad left in the sun for an hour: cheerful, glossy, and fading fast.
This is an aromatic fruit loose candy rather than a complex composition. It smells like a neon pineapple sticker pressed onto a glass window, vivid from one angle, transparent from another. The longevity clocks in at barely two hours; the sillage is a close, polite cloud that vanishes with a shrug. That rating of 3.79 makes sense, it delivers on the fruity hype but refuses to stick around.
Wear it for an afternoon picnic, a beach stroll, or a hot day when you want something uncomplicated and sweet. It suits anyone who loves a gummy pineapple treat and doesn’t mind reapplying every hour. Skip it if you crave depth, projection, or a fragrance that survives past lunch.
